I had the same problem as you!. I went to my local doctor and she suggested the Implanon rod for me!. They give you a local anaesthetic in the arm you want it in and they insert the rod in there, it doesn't hurt and you cant feel anything!. The rod is left in for two years and removed by a similar procedure!. You can have the rod removed anytime you like so you can have it removed a year later and i think its only a few week after it has been removed your able to get pregnant!. I found it a life saver and it really has worked for me!. Its worth a shot!. There are alot of myths about it like it can break or it can drift around your arm but this can only happen if the rod is not inserted properly and you can tell that by how it feels in your arm!. After a while you wont even know its there!. Hope this helps :)Www@Answer-Health@Com

You could try NuvaRing!. You use it for 3 weeks just like the pill and then rest for 1!. Unlike the pill that you have to take daily, NuvaRing is inserted vaginally (by yoursefl) and stays in place for 3 weeks!. You remove it for one and get a period!. It is 99!.9% effective just like the pill!. Maybe you could try using condoms to make it 100% effective!. Good Luck!Www@Answer-Health@Com
